linux

Linux syslog有哪些安全防护措施

小樊
46
2025-07-30 01:03:40
栏目: 智能运维

Linux系统的Syslog服务是系统日志收集和管理的关键组件,对于保障系统安全具有重要意义。为了确保Syslog的安全性,可以采取以下措施:

  1. 加密传输:使用TLS/SSL等协议对日志数据进行加密,确保在传输过程中的安全性。
  2. 访问控制:通过配置防火墙规则,限制对Syslog端口的访问,确保只有受信任的网络或IP地址可以访问。
  3. 日志轮转和压缩:配置日志轮转和压缩,以节省存储空间并减少带宽占用。
  4. 安全配置:对Syslog服务器进行安全配置,如设置访问控制列表(ACL)和启用加密传输和身份验证功能。
  5. 监控和报警:设置监控和报警机制,以便在重要事件发生时及时通知相关人员。
  6. 限制日志记录:根据实际需求,限制日志记录的详细程度和保留时间。
  7. 定期安全审计:定期进行安全审计,检查Syslog配置和日志文件,以确保没有潜在的安全风险。
  8. 备份日志文件:定期备份日志文件,以防万一发生攻击或数据丢失。
  9. 禁用不必要的超级用户账户:检查并删除不必要的超级用户账户,以减少潜在的安全风险。
  10. 设置强密码:为所有用户账户设置复杂且独特的密码,避免使用默认或简单的密码。
  11. 使用SELinux/AppArmor:如果系统启用了SELinux或AppArmor,配置它们来限制Syslog服务的权限和访问。
  12. 日志集中管理:将日志发送到远程的日志审计中心,以便进行集中分析和监控。
  13. 最小权限原则:为Syslog服务分配尽可能少的权限,以减少潜在的攻击面。

0
看了该问题的人还看了